Securing Your Automated Control System: A Handbook to Cyber Security Best Methods
Maintaining the integrity of your BMS is essential in today's digital world. Implementing robust cyber safety practices is not simply a luxury but a necessity . This involves multiple levels of defense , from frequently revising firmware and hardware to enforcing strong authentication and data separation. Moreover , personnel awareness on typical threats like phishing emails and ransomware is critical . Finally , performing periodic vulnerability assessments can enable identify and resolve potential weaknesses before they can be taken advantage of.

Implementing a Robust Digital Safety Plan for Your BMS
To maintain the security of your Building Management System (BMS), crafting a solid digital protection plan is critical . This plan should handle potential threats such as cyberattacks . Begin by performing a thorough evaluation of your current system, locating all connected systems. Subsequently, deploy various stages of protection, including:
- Firewalls and Intrusion Detection
- Regular system refreshes
- Strong access controls
- staff awareness on safe online habits
- A disaster recovery plan to address unforeseen problems.
Finally, consistently review your network and adjust your plan as new threats appear .
